Következtetés heise online
A WPF és a Windows Forms alkalmazások áttérése a klasszikus .NET-keretrendszerről a .NET Core-ra sajnos nem néhány egérkattintással történik, hanem igazi kattintási orgiát jelent. A bemutatott PowerShell-szkript megkönnyítheti a munka legalább egy részét. A szkript azonban nem mentesítheti a fejlesztőt a megszűnt vagy megváltozott API-k újraprogramozásáról.

Magában a WPF alkalmazás keretrendszerében alig vannak lényeges változások. Kevés régebbi vezérlőt hagytak ki a Windows űrlapokból. Számításba kell venni az alaposztályok sok API-jának és viselkedésének változásának idejét, amelyeket sajnos még nem dokumentáltak strukturált módon.
Ezenkívül figyelembe kell venni a migráció általános akadályait is, amelyeket a sorozat nyitó cikkében tárgyaltunk, beleértve a csökkentett támogatási időtartamot és a .NET Core-hoz használt harmadik féltől származó komponensek elérhetőségét.
Dr. Holger Schwichtenberg
a .NET és a web technológiák egyik legismertebb szakértője Németországban. 35 másik szakértővel együtt tanácsokkal és képzésekkel segíti a közepes és nagyvállalatokat a Windows és a webalkalmazások létrehozásában a www.IT-Visions.de vállalat keretein belül. Számos szakkönyvet is megjelentetett a .NET, a PowerShell és a JavaScript/TypeScript témában. Kövesse őt a Twitteren a @DOTNETDOKTOR címen.
kötődés
Listázás: PowerShell-szkript egy WPF-alkalmazás áttelepítéséhez a klasszikus .NET-keretrendszerből a .NET Core 3.1-be